ST. PETERSBURG, Fla.-(June 6, 2018) – The St. Petersburg Area Economic Development Corporation (EDC) partnered with the Florida-Israel Business Accelerator (FIBA) to host 6 Israeli companies considering a U.S. Operation for the event, “Meet the Companies” on June 5. The forum, held at 3 Daughter’s Brewing provided the opportunity for the six dynamic companies to present their respective business models and hear first hand from the community about doing business in St. Petersburg.
Rachel Marks Feinman, Executive Director for FIBA, kicked off the event with an overview of the Accelerator’s mission and introduced participating entrepreneurs that included companies from the Data Analytics, Manufacturing, and Life & Marine Sciences industries.
“The success of FIBA in attracting Israeli companies to establish offices here in Tampa Bay depends on the support of the whole community,” Rachel Feinman, Executive Director of FIBA said. “The support from J.P.’s team at the St. Pete EDC and from each of its investors to warmly welcome our group makes a lasting impact on our companies.”
Florida Blue, Tech Data, Presence, and Grow FL were among the more than 40 St. Petersburg companies represented at the event.
“It’s very encouraging to see the partnership between the St. Petersburg EDC and the Florida-Israel Business Alliance driving innovative companies to our region,” David Punzak, St. Petersburg EDC Chairman said. “The companies that presented and engaged with the St. Pete community align well with our Grow Smarter Strategy’s identified target industries, and each company would be a great asset to our City.”

About the St. Petersburg Economic Development Corporation
The St. Petersburg Area Economic Development Corporation, a private-public partnership between over 40 investors and the City of St. Petersburg, is a partner in the Grow Smarter Strategy to create awareness of the business climate in St. Petersburg and to invigorate the growth of jobs in the target sectors of marine and life sciences, data analytics, financial and business services, specialized manufacturing and creative arts and design.
About Florida Israeli Business Accelerator
(FIBA) is a Florida-based technology accelerator that is designed to establish and grow successful, high-growth Israeli and Florida tech ventures in the Tampa Bay Area. FIBA assists the innovative companies to overcome the hardships involved with entering a market by providing entrepreneurs with strategic alignment with corporate partners, consulting on localization and expansion, guidance on Go-to-Market strategies, access to prospective customers, investors and service providers, assistance with sales and lead generation activities and support with establishing and expanding a U.S. office and operation. www.fiba.io
